In an exciting development for residents of Salekhard and Khanty-Mansiysk, RusLine has announced the launch of a new weekly flight between the two West Siberian locations. Starting from August 9, 2025, a second flight will take off from Salekhard (YNAO) and land in Khanty-Mansiysk (HMAO) every Saturday[1].

The scheduled departure time from Salekhard is 6:30 PM, with an expected arrival time in Khanty-Mansiysk of 7:40 PM on the same day[3]. This indicates the flight duration will be approximately 1 hour and 10 minutes. However, details about the aircraft type and return flights were not provided in the announcement.

This new weekend service aims to enhance RusLine’s regional connectivity, making business and personal travel planning more convenient for residents of both regions[7]. The airline has noted a consistent demand for air travel between Yamal and Yugra, and launching additional Saturday flights is a logical step to increase the route's accessibility[5].
